he recent first birthday on 12th December of the Bevendean Community Pub provided just the opportunity that I needed to visit and find out more. The ‘Bevy’ at 50 Hillside in Brighton began as the Bevendean Hotel and was built by Portsmouth & Brighton United Breweries to the designs of architect Stavers Hessell Tiltman in 1936. Tiltman designed and modified a number of pubs for this particular brewery company including the Tudorstyle Downs Hotel in Woodingdean in 1938. His masterpiece though was the Modernist terminal building at Shoreham Airport that was completed in 1935. The Bevendean Hotel was closed on police advice in 2010 and put up for sale. The building was bought for £250,000 by East Brighton Trust, a local It is the first community interest communitycompany that provides grants to worthy causes owned pub on a in the area. It was at this council estate in point that a number of the country residents, including Warren Carter whom I have mentioned previously as the driving force behind the nearby Moulsecoomb Forest Garden, set up a new pub as a co-operative with assistance from the Plunkett Foundation. It is the first communityowned pub on a council estate in the country and now has around 800 shareholders (many of whom helped with the refurbishment

work). This is a serious achievement. I visited in December with my friend Nigel McMillan, the Brightonbased architect whose designs for the building have proved to be a complete success. Opening up the ground floor as a flexible space makes complete sense, as does adding three flats upstairs to provide the income that ultimately underpins this project and others. Architecturally, the Bevendean Hotel shares many features with the other local 1930s suburban pubs such as the Nevill, Grenadier, Long Man and Ladies Mile. Their pitched roofs, multi-paned windows and maintenance-free red bricks have certainly stood the test of time. www.buildingopinions.com Twitter: @robert_nemeth 7

The Grand supports local businesses – Samantha Harman finds out more n terms of business in the city and what I believe would make Brighton even greater, I will just filter it down to my business and my industry – not just at The Grand, but business as the tourism industry as a whole. Clearly it is of massive importance, the stats from VisitBrighton show the turnover of tourism, the millions it brings to the local economy and the thousands of people it employs. This highlights the importance of tourism to peripheral business within the city, so when tourists arrive, it's not just about the hotel and catering businesses they're using, it's also about all of the other facilities as well – from car parks to all of the other iconic attractions. There are so many things that are intrinsically linked into bringing tourism here. The worry I have is that tourism is falling off the agenda through the necessary cuts in funding. It has been widely reported what these cuts look like and while I am the first to accept that cuts will The happen, I believe that in the worry I spirit of fairness they need to have is that be applied to all sectors. The concern that I have if these tourism is cuts take place and this falling off the could be as soon as 2020 – is agenda that it's going to leave us in a very difficult place to promote Brighton as a tourism industry. At The Grand we will continue to do our bit as a private business to not only promote our establishment, but also to promote Brighton as a destination. There is some trepidation going forward that this money is being so significantly reduced that the opportunity and the ability to promote Brighton as a destination is diminishing.

This issue marries hand-in-hand with the resurgence of some of our competitor destinations, such as Liverpool. In recent years we've seen the city leap forward and this is attracting some of the big association conferences. For instance, some of the party political and the trade union congresses. Manchester is very strong. Birmingham has also improved along with re-emerging centres such as Belfast, which albeit is less accessible because of the flight. Rival seaside town Bournemouth has had £200m invested into it over the last few years, and as it is only 80 miles down the coast, this is a significant threat to Brighton. We need similar funding in order to make sure that we are able to continue attracting business and leisure tourism into the city and that we remain strong. We inevitably have our varied unique selling points – the proximity to London, the quirky bohemian style is always going to appeal and is something we need to maintain. But we need to ensure that the message is getting out there. In my opinion we all need to pull together and do whatever we can to ensure that continues to happen. A number of hotels have really been investing in the last year or so with considerable plans on the table for the next few years, including ourselves. There are exciting times ahead in 2016, from the launch of the British Airways i360 to the seafront regeneration project, which will certainly help attract visitors to Brighton. CITY PLANNER CAROL ALGAR MASTERS DEGREE STUDENT

HOVE STATION NEIGHBOURHOOD FORUM

contingent of Brighton University Planning School students recently attended a meeting of the Hove Station Neighbourhood Forum on Saturday 21st November. It was an opportunity for local residents to join the drop-in public meeting to hear about the latest development proposals for the area, share their opinions and raise questions with key stakeholders, including Rob Fraser, Brighton and Hove City Council Planning Officer and representatives from Matsim Properties and Mountpark Properties, the respective owners/developers for the Conway and Ellen Street redevelopment and Sackville Trading Estate and the Coal Yard. Under the Coalition Government’s steam, the Localism Act 2011 has set about changes to the planning system to reduce regulation, devolving power from central government and enabling local communities to get involved with developing their own neighbourhood development plans. The involvement is voluntary but, under the act, new rights and powers are given to parish councils or designated neighbourhood forums. Although the people that make up the Committee members of such forums are voluntary, they are no less qualified and the Hove Station Neighbourhood Forum is a good example of this, being led by a number of highly experienced professionals, including a local architect and a planning professional. All the committee members are local residents, not only with a vested interest in the development of the area, but a wealth of expertise to enable the designated Hove Station community to actively engage in shaping the neighbourhood plan and future development within the community. Before all the NIMBYists jump up and enrol themselves in their local forum, it should be noted however that neighbourhood development plans are designed to work alongside an area’s local plan – in the case of Brighton and Hove, the City Plan, which is expected to be formally adopted in 2016. The City Plan is the Council’s key planning document and will provide the overall strategic vision for the future of Brighton and Hove to 2030. Neighbourhood Development Plans have to incorporate certain conditions including conforming with national planning policy and strategic policies in the local development plan plus a necessity to meet certain EU obligations. Neighbourhood Development Plans shouldn’t be seen as a way to make development happen or block local development but rather as an opportunity for residents to work with the council, planning professionals and developers to help create thriving and empowered communities and meet identified housing need and employment land requirements. From the information provided at the meeting, the proposals seemed very interesting. Hove Gardens is a mixed use development with 178 flats and business/retail units with 21,500 sq. ft. of grade A office space. Currently a brownfield site, this proposal seems an attractive and well-designed scheme with a considerable amount of office space, helping to meet the employment needs of a growing city population. I’m looking forward to hearing more on how the proposals progress and to what extent the Hove Station Forum has been able to influence development in the area. ow I am pretty established in the shop it's been great that people now bring things in for me to look at, evaluate and sell. This means that new, and sometimes unseen, items are appearing on a regular basis. I also buy regularly from the local auction houses, and this week I bought a fabulous tourist guide book from 1938/39 just for the town of Hove. The book is very 30s with vivid colouring and style... as Hove has! Inside there is an abundance of local facts and figures and photos and info, just on Hove. Brighton, it seems, may as well have been 100 miles away and not next door since it was not in anyway connected for the well-heeled Hove visitor apart from “The Brighton, Hove and Shoreham Airport" – which I have always felt was almost as bad as London Gatwick!!!! Anyway back to the guide book. The picture that caught my eye, from a property point of view, was the photo of Woodland Drive looking up with the Tudor style houses on the left (valued then at about £9,000), and on the right nothing – as this side was not built on until the 60s. No shops at Woodland Parade, in fact no shops anywhere to be seen until Church Road. The last shot is an aerial view along the Brighton, it Kingsway from the Peace seems, may Statue at the border of as well have been Brighton and Hove with the recently built 100 miles away Courtenay Gate (circa 1934) block of flats which were rented from£180-£400 per year (yes 52 weeks). It benefited from communal central heating and crittall metal windows, which at the time were building innovations but as a lot of us know are actually a living nightmare! More stuff next week.
